Hermann Hesse
Born: Jul 2, 1877 in Calw, Württemberg, Germany |
Died: Aug 9, 1962 (at age 85) in Montagnola, Ticino, Switzerland |
Nationality: German-Swiss |
Famous For:The Glass Bead Game, Demian, Steppenwolf, Siddhartha |
Awards: Goethe Prize (1946), Nobel Prize in Literature (1946) |
Hermann Hesse was German-born writer and painter. His greatest works include Siddhartha, Steppenwolf, and The Glass Bead Game. Each of these works explore a person’s search for self-knowledge, authenticity, and spirituality. He was awarded the Nobel Prize in Literature in 1946.
Hesse’s Early Years
Hesse was born in July of 1877 in the town of Calw (Black Forest) in Württemberg, Germany. His parents were Pietist missionaries, as well as religious publishers. Hesse was expected to follow his family tradition of theology. In 1891, he entered a Protestant seminary in Maulbronn, but was expelled. After several unhappy experiences (including a suicide attempt) at other educational institutions, he enrolled at the Cannstatt’s Gymnasium. Hesse passed his one-year examination in 1893, which concluded his education.
